Bhagwan Anjanappa wrote: > My apologies to one and all for not being specific in my previous > mail. Well having said that, I am using Win 2000 and when I try to > configure httperf tool on Cygwin the command I give is as below.... > however my Cygwin tool and httperf tool are installed on saperate > Drives in the Hard disk. What part of "please provide the requested cygcheck output" was not clear? It would have made the cause of your problem instantly obvious. > conftest.c 1>&5 gcc: installation problem, cannot exec `as': No such > file or directory configure: failed program was: Binutils contains the assembler (as) which is required to use gcc. Your problem therefore is that either you did not install binutils or the installation failed. (I don't know how one can manage to install gcc without binutils though, because the setup.exe tool should have selected binutils for you when you selected gcc, and it should have loudly complained that there was an unmet dependency if you overrode its choice.)
